Smart Weather Condition Sensors
Smart climate sensing units have revolutionized the efficiency of contemporary irrigation systems by readjusting watering schedules based on real-time ecological data. These sensing units monitor variables such as temperature, humidity, wind rate, and solar radiation, permitting systems to respond dynamically to changing climate problems. By integrating this data, clever sensors can maximize water usage, lowering waste and guaranteeing that landscapes obtain the ideal amount of wetness. This modern technology not just preserves water yet likewise promotes much healthier plant development by stopping overwatering or underwatering. In addition, the automation offered by wise weather sensors improves individual convenience, as landscapers and home owners can depend on precise watering timetables without hand-operated treatment. Dirt Dampness Sensors
Soil dampness sensors play a vital duty in modern-day watering systems, supplying real-time information that boosts water efficiency. These tools determine the volumetric water content in the dirt, enabling exact evaluations of moisture levels. By integrating soil wetness sensing units right into watering systems, customers can avoid overwatering or underwatering, eventually promoting healthier plant development and preserving water resources.The sensing units transfer information to controllers, which can readjust sprinkling schedules based upon present dirt conditions. This data-driven method minimizes water waste and guarantees that plants receive the most effective amount of moisture. Customizable Setting Up Choices
Exactly how can customizable scheduling options transform irrigation methods? These options enable customers to tailor sprinkling routines according to specific plant demands, weather problems, and seasonal changes. By enabling precise control over when and just how much water is used, personalized scheduling improves water preservation and promotes healthier plant growth.Modern lawn sprinkler systems typically include programmable setups that suit various watering needs, such as various zones for diverse plant types. Customers can set schedules based upon time of day, regularity, and duration, ensuring optimal hydration without waste (Irrigation repair and service).Furthermore, progressed systems can integrate local weather data to readjust schedules instantly, protecting against overwatering throughout wet durations. This versatility not only enhances irrigation effectiveness however also minimizes water costs and environmental impact. What Is the Life-span of Modern Lawn Sprinkler Parts?
The lifespan of modern-day sprinkler system elements typically varies from 5 to two decades, depending on the products utilized, maintenance methods, and ecological problems. Routine upkeep can greatly enhance resilience and performance gradually.
